次の方法で共有


ResUtilGetResourceNameDependencyEx 関数 (resapi.h)

ローカル クラスター内の指定したリソース依存関係を列挙し、指定したリソースの種類の依存関係へのハンドルを返します。 PRESUTIL_GET_RESOURCE_NAME_DEPENDENCY_EX型は、この関数へのポインターを定義します。

構文

HRESOURCE ResUtilGetResourceNameDependencyEx(
  [in] LPCWSTR lpszResourceName,
  [in] LPCWSTR lpszResourceType,
  [in] DWORD   dwDesiredAccess
);

パラメーター

[in] lpszResourceName

依存リソースの名前を指定する null で終わる Unicode 文字列。 このリソースは、1 つ以上のリソースに依存します。

[in] lpszResourceType

返される依存関係のリソースの種類を指定する null で終わる Unicode 文字列。

[in] dwDesiredAccess

要求されたアクセス特権。 これは、 GENERIC_READ (0x80000000 )、GENERIC_ALL ( 0x10000000 )、または MAXIMUM_ALLOWED (0x02000000) の任意の組み合わせです。 この値が 0 (0) の場合は、未定義のエラーが返される可能性があります。 GENERIC_ALLの使用は、ResUtilGetResourceNameDependency の呼び出しと同じです。

戻り値

操作が成功した場合、関数は lpszResourceName で指定されたリソースが依存するリソースのいずれかにハンドルを返します。 呼び出し元は、 CloseClusterResource を呼び出してハンドルを閉じる役割を担います。

操作が失敗した場合、関数は NULL を返します。 詳細については、 GetLastError 関数を呼び出します。

要件

要件
サポートされている最小のクライアント サポートなし
サポートされている最小のサーバー Windows Server 2012
対象プラットフォーム Windows
ヘッダー resapi.h
Library ResUtils.lib
[DLL] ResUtils.dll

こちらもご覧ください

リソース ユーティリティ関数